A teenage girl suspected of stabbing her twin brother was taken into custody by Yuma County Sheriff’s Office deputies.
The incident happened at about 7:42 a.m. in the area of East 24th Place and Fortuna Road, in Yuma, Arizona.
Deputies say the girl stabbed her twin in the leg and then ran away. She was apprehended by law enforcement at an undisclosed location a short time later.
The boy was taken to Yuma Regional Medical Center and is expected to make a full recovery.
Neighbors say the incident started after the two had an argument.
The names of the teens are being withheld because of their age.
